Dyscritellina aculeata
Taxonomy
Dyscritellina aculeata was named by Morozova (1986). Its type specimen is PIN 2830/737 and is a 3D body fossil. Its type locality is Kotel'nyy Island, east coast, New Siberian Islands, which is in a Roadian/Wordian marine horizon in the Russian Federation.
